Signs Your Roof and Gutters Need Attention

It’s critical for homeowners to note the telltale signs of gutter and roofing problems. If you’re seeing any signs of sagging or detachment in your gutters, or if water isn’t flowing properly, it’s time for a closer look. Another red flag is the presence of water stains on your siding, or peeling paint around your gutters, indicating potential water intrusion. On the roof, missing, cracked, or curling shingles can spell trouble and warrant immediate expert evaluation. Being proactive with these signs can avert water-related disasters that may otherwise wreak extensive havoc on your home.

Final Considerations for Homeowners

As the seasons change in Plano, so do the requirements of your home’s exterior upkeep. Faced with the harsh conditions of winter, the importance of well-maintained gutters and roofing cannot be overstressed, as these elements work collaboratively to protect your abode. Ensuring that your gutters are clear of debris helps prevent the formation of ice dams, which can force water under your roofing material, compromising both your gutters and roof’s structural integrity. The addition of heat cables or improved insulation may be advised for additional protection against the cold. Taking these steps will fortify your home against the elements and guarantee a hassle-free winter season.

Insights From The Experts

Tip 1:

Ensure your gutters are cleaned at least twice a year to prevent blockages. Keeping them clear of leaves and debris allows for efficient water flow and prevents potential water damage to your property.

Tip 2:

Include checking for loose or damaged shingles in your roof inspection routine. Early detection and replacement of compromised shingles can pr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s down the road.

Tip 3:

Look for signs of gutter misalignment or sagging during regular inspections. Properly aligned and secured gutters are crucial for effective water runoff and to prevent overflow during heavy rain.

Tip 4:

In winter, pay special attention to potential ice dams, which can force water under the roof covering. Installing heat cables or improving attic insulation can mitigate this risk and protect the integrity of your roof.

Tip 5:

Consider a professional gutter guard installation to reduce maintenance needs. Gutter guards can prevent larger debris from entering the gutter system and reduce the frequency of cleaning required.

Your Roofing Questions Answered

How often should gutters be cleaned in Plano to prevent damage?

In Plano, it’s recommended to clean gutters at least twice a year—once in late spring and once in early fall—to prevent clogs and potential damage from storms and falling leaves.

What are signs that indicate my gutters need repairs?

Visible sagging, water spillage during rainstorms, rust or cracks, and the presence of pests are clear indicators that your gutters may need repairing or replacing.

Can consistent roof inspections prolong the life of my roof?

Absolutely, regular roof inspections can identify potential issues early on and lead to repairs that extend the overall lifespan of your roofing system.

What should be included in a thorough roof inspection?

A comprehensive roof inspection should include checking for damaged or missing shingles, examining the integrity of roof flashing, and ensuring proper attic ventilation.

How does regular gutter and roof maintenance impact home value?

Maintaining your gutters and roof not only protects the structural integrity of your home but can also enhance its curb appeal and overall market value.
